R. O. T. C. ASKED TO FIRE SALUTE

Ancient and Honorable Field Artillery Extends Invitation

NO WRITER ATTRIBUTED

The University Field Artillery Unit has been asked by the Ancient and Honorable Artillery Company of Boston to fire a salute at the time of their annual field day on June 7. The R. O. T. C. will do so if a sufficient number of students have no college engagements at that time. Two sections will be formed; the enlisted personnel attached to the unit driving the pieces, and the students, who volunteer for the occasion, firing the salute. Several men have already signed up and it is expected that more will do so today.
